1. Start with an accurate El Sobrante service area

El Sobrante is recorded as a census-designated place in Contra Costa County, California. The 2020–2024 American Community Survey 5-year population estimate for the El Sobrante CDP is 16,294, with a margin of error of 1,702. That is geographic context, not proof of legal demand, competition, search volume, leads, cases, or revenue. Your website should therefore avoid treating the population estimate as a marketing result. Instead, use it to begin a service-area review: does your firm actually serve El Sobrante, which parts of Contra Costa County does it serve, and are those relationships stated consistently across the site?

4. Treat AI citation as an evaluation target, not a promise

Bosseo presents AI SEO as a way to make a firm easier for systems such as ChatGPT, Google Gemini, Perplexity, Claude, and Google AI Overviews to read, verify, and cite. The public page also states that no one can honestly guarantee what an AI model will say. Google’s guidance says that scaled content needs original value, accuracy, and relevance, and that automation does not guarantee crawling, indexing, or search visibility. These limits matter when evaluating an El Sobrante program: citation should be reviewed as an observable outcome, not represented as an assured result.

Recommended approach

Agree in advance on what will be reviewed: whether pages are accessible, whether content is accurate and useful, whether search systems show or cite the firm for selected questions, and whether qualified inquiries can be identified. Keep those observations separate from assumptions about demand or future performance.
